摘要
This paper describes the synthesis and characterization of the non- symmetric ligands CH3SCH2CH2SRf(R-f = C6F5, C6HF4-4, C6H4F-2, C6H4F-3, C6H4F-4) as well as their platinum(II) derivatives cis-[PtCl2(CH3SCH2CH2SRf)] (R-f = C6F5, C6HF4-4, C6H4F-2, C6H4F-3, C6H4F-4) and trans-[PtCl2(CH3SCH2CH2SRf)(2)] (R-f = C6F5, C6HF4-4). F-19 NMR of these complexes show the presence of syn and anti isomers, consistent with a fast flipping of the metallacycle ring and a slow inversion of configuration at the dithioether sulfur atoms. The molecular and crystalline structures of the compounds cis-[PtCl2(CH3SCH2CH2SC6F5)], cis-[PtCl2(CH3SCH2CH2SC6H4F-3)] and trans[ PtCl2(CH3SCH2CH2SC6F5)(2)], solved by X-ray diffraction are also described.
